Spring Repair in Rio Del Mar
Torsion springs snap prematurely here. The combination of Monterey Bay’s salt-laden marine layer and persistent dampness from the coastal fog causes springs to corrode and fail in as little as 2–4 years, whereas inland communities like Scotts Valley see 7–10 year lifespans. We recently replaced the torsion spring on a mid-century beach cottage on Seacliff Drive in Rio Del Mar. The homeowner had moved from San Jose and was shocked to find bright orange rust scaling on a spring that was only three years old. We installed a galvanized spring and stainless steel cables, and upgraded the rollers to nylon to resist the salt air. Spring repair in Rio Del Mar runs $180–$340.
Cable Repair in Rio Del Mar
Uncoated cables fray and corrode in Rio Del Mar’s damp, salt-saturated garage interiors—failure patterns rarely seen just a few miles inland. Bare steel cables turn brittle where the marine layer penetrates even well-sealed garages. We stock corrosion-resistant replacement cables and routinely pair cable replacement with galvanized spring upgrades for homeowners who want to break the cycle of premature failure. Cable repair in Rio Del Mar typically costs $130–$250.
Track Realignment for Coastal Conditions
Bare steel tracks rust and seize in Rio Del Mar’s environment, causing doors to bind, shudder, or operate with grinding noise. The persistent dampness accelerates oxidation on track surfaces and roller contact points. We clean, realign, and lubricate tracks with coastal-appropriate compounds, and we’ll flag when corrosion has progressed beyond salvage—sometimes the smarter fix is replacement with galvanized track sections. Track realignment runs $140–$285.

Common Garage Door Repair Problems We See in Rio Del Mar Homes
- Torsion springs snap with visible orange rust scaling after only 2–4 years. Technicians working Rio Del Mar’s beachfront blocks regularly find this failure pattern—it surprises homeowners who relocated from inland areas and expect standard lifespans. Quoting a full corrosion-resistant hardware package upfront is standard practice here, not an add-on.
- Bare steel tracks and hinges rust and seize, causing doors to bind or operate noisily. The persistent Monterey Bay marine layer means garage interiors stay damp and salt-saturated year-round, even without direct ocean spray. This accelerates rust on bare steel tracks in ways rarely seen just a few miles inland.
- Wooden door panels swell and warp from constant dampness, leading to misalignment and seal failure. Rio Del Mar’s core of mid-century beach cottages from the 1950s–1970s often features original wooden doors that weren’t designed for full-time residential exposure to coastal conditions.
- Post-Loma Prieta rebuilds and additions create mixed construction eras on the same streets. A 1989-era garage on one property may have modern clearances and hardware, while the neighboring 1962 cottage has low-headroom constraints and non-standard widths—each requiring different repair approaches.
Pricing for Garage Door Repair in Rio Del Mar, CA
Most garage door repairs in Rio Del Mar fall between $175–$710, with the majority of spring and cable jobs landing in the mid-range. Coastal conditions here mean we often recommend corrosion-resistant upgrades—galvanized springs, stainless cables, nylon rollers—that add modest cost upfront but prevent repeat failures.
| Service | Price Range in Rio Del Mar |
|---|---|
| Spring Repair | $180–$340 |
| Cable Repair | $130–$250 |
| Roller Replacement | $110–$220 |
| Track Realignment | $140–$285 |
| Panel Replacement | $295–$590 |
| Opener Repair | $140–$380 |
| New Door Installation | $825–$2,595 |
